YOUR GUIDE TO LEH KUSHOK BAKULA RIMPOCHE AIRPORT
General Information
Location : LEH IND ICAO/IATA : VILH/IXL Lat/Long : N34o 08.2', E077o 32.8'
Sunrise: 0135 Z Sunset : 1141 Z
Runway Information Runway : 07 Length X Width : 9555 ft X 150 ft Surface Type : asphalt TDZ-Elev : 10859 ft
Communication Information Leh Tower : 127.300
1. Introduction Leh airfield marks the most difficult approach in India. We have adapted the real-life procedures with necessary changes and omissions in this chart. Aircrafts flying to and from LEH are specially equipped for high altitude operations, in particular the HIGH ALTITUDE LANDING switch. Depending on your sim and aircraft vendor, you might not have this mode. You can still fly to LEH on IVAO with its absence, but it will call for manually controlling pressurization and cancelling cabin altitude warnings. Radar vectoring during approach and departure will not available below FL200 due to terrain restrictions.
ENSURE YOU HAVE READ AND FOLLOW THE PROCEDURES IN THIS CHART DURING EVENTS, ELSE YOU MIGHT BE ASKED TO DISCONNECT .
2. Airfield Information The airfield lies North of River Indus. The Indo‐Pakistan Line of Actual Control runs around 50 NM Northwest of Leh airfield. Due to mountainous terrain, operations to / from Leh terminal area and part of route segment are permitted only for VFR operations. You must file your Flight Rules as Y ( IFR - VFR) for arrivals and Z (VFR - IFR) for departures on IVA P. Due to the high altitude and terrain, there will be severe performance limitations, be sure to fly with an appropriately loaded aircraft.

4. Special notes
Being a performance limited runway, flight crew must be careful in correct line‐up point for takeoff and also not to lose runway while setting take‐off thrust due negative runway slope.
When conditions are below ISA, i.e. when Leh runway temperature is
less than ‐6o C, the pressure altimeter shall be over‐reading. Exercise caution.
We are publishing only one approach and departure procedure each. The routing ensures you can depart onto or arrive from the W39 airway.
Due to the high altitude expect to use more thrust to taxi.
Only taxiway A and B are allowed for civil ops. Do not vacate/enter onto any other taxiway unless operating as military traffic.
Only Flaps 1 (Both A320 and 737) is to be used for departure, with full thrust and no reduced thrust. Engine bleeds must be off with APU running for takeoff. (APU bleed available till approx. 17000 ft)
Take-off thrust rating is available for 10 minutes, if required. Fire-walling of engines is permitted.
Pilots must create the waypoints given in next page and follow the appropriate route at all times.
Keep a keen lookout to ensure terrain clearance and correct altitude at check points

6. Arrival
Routing: Aircrafts arriving into Leh must follow the route below to land at
runway 07.
LELAX -> LH01 -> LH02 -> LLH -> LH03 -> LH04 -> LH05 -> LH06
Point Latitude Longitude LH01 N 33 19.0 E 078 02.0
LH02 N 34 00.0 E 077 39.9
LH03 N 34 08.4 E 077 33.6
LH04 N 34 11.0 E 077 29.3
LH05 N 34 08.5 E 077 27.6
LH06 N 34 07.2 E 077 29.7
LH07 N 34 11.1 E 077 23.8
LH08 N 34 11.6 E 077 17.0
LH09 N 34 12.4 E 077 13.5
LH10 N 34 11.5 E 077 20.1
It is advised to keep autopilot on to at least waypoint LH05. Pilots should
ensure proper energy management by getting into landing config. a bit
early than late. Max bank of 25o can be used. You might get cabin
altitude warnings and "descend profile too steep" warnings, ensure to
ignore the former and to make the latter null and void by staying
within flight envelope. You will have to disable GPWS warnings.
Page has the essential supplementary items to normal checklist for both
A320 and B737 family.
TRANSITION ALTITUDE : 24000 ft Visual approach TRANSITION LEVEL (QNH<=1013hpa) : FL 225 TRANSITION LEVEL (QNH<=1013hpa) : FL 250 Airport Elevation 10859'
Point Altitude Speed LH01 +/at FL230 Minimum clean speed
LH02 16000ft 150kts
LLH Fmc profile Vapp
LH03 14500ft Vapp
LH04 13000ft Vapp
LH05 12000ft Vapp
LH06 11200ft Vapp
Gear down, landing flaps and Vapp by LLH
7 Leh Approach & Landing Quick Reference
Airbus A318/A319/A320 At TOD: o HIGH ALT LANDING switch - ON o ANTI ICE - As required o MCDU Landing Flaps - Conf 3, ensure no CF for RW07
If No Engine Bleed Landing is required, start APU o GPWS: TERR & SYS - OFF o LDG FLAP 3 - ON
At Transition Level or as advised by ATC:
o Set LEH QNH and carry out/complete Normal Approach checklist At 16000 ft
o Auto/BRK - MED o Approach mode - Activate o If no engine bleed landing - verify APU bleed on and cabin pressure stabilized
By LLH carryout normal landing checklist, flaps 3 and gear down.
Boeing 737 / 738
At TOD: o Select HIGH ALT LAND switch ‐ ON o Set LAND ALT indicator ‐ 10900 ft. o ANTI ICE - As required
If No Engine Bleed Landing is required, start APU o Select TERRAIN Switch – ON o Carry out Normal Descent Check List
At Transition Level or as advised by ATC:
o Set LEH QNH and carry out/complete Normal Approach checklist At 20000 ft
o Flap Inhibit Switch ‐ Inhibit
At 16000 ft
o Auto brake - 3 o If no engine bleed landing - verify APU bleed on and cabin pressure stabilized
By LLH carryout normal landing checklist, flaps 3 and gear down.
8. Departure
Routing: Aircrafts departing from Leh must follow the route out of runway 25.
LH06 -> LH05 -> LH07 -> Lh08 -> LH09 -> LH10 -> LH05 -> LLH
Turn right immediately after reaching South bank of river Indus. Climb to 18000 ft with TO/GA thrust, start inbound turn to LH10 only after reaching 21000 ft at 180 kts or below, flaps 1. Use max bank 30o for inbound turn. Cleanup by LLH. Report to assigned controller when overhead LLH to establish and proceed on W39 airway.
9. Missed approach If not stabilised by 10900 ft (Leh QNH) on finals, it is mandatory to go- around. Go-around flaps setting shall be Flaps 1. Turn RIGHT climbing to on track 100(M). Continue climbing to point LH01, select flaps 5, turn LEFT and continue climbing to report over LLH. On clearance from ATC, while approaching point LH02, select gear down, landing config flaps and follow the normal approach and landing procedure.
Ground movements o Pushback is unavailable, all stands are taxi-in and taxi-out. Pilots
must confirm apron along with stand.
o Apron 2: Aircrafts must taxi straight into B and turn left at the end of B to park in their respective stands facing South.
o Departing aircrafts are only allowed via A, ensure to backtrack 07
and lineup at the beginning of 25.
o Runway 25 is used for departures only and 07 for arrivals only.
o Single engine taxi is not allowed.
o De-icing facilities unavailable, pilots must be cautious about ice buildup.
10. Creating Waypoints
It is mandatory to create and follow custom waypoints to avoid high terrain
areas, also atc will use these points are reference. If you are unaware about
how to do so, this we will be your perfect opportunity to learn. We are using
A320, B737 for example as they are most commonly flown types to this
airfield.
Airbus A319/320/321
Select DATA on the MCDU.
Navigate to the next page using Right Arrow key.
Press R1 LSK -
"PILOT WAYPOINTS" Enables creation, review and
deletion of pilot-defined WPTs.
Press R5 LSK - "NEW WAYPOINT" Pressing R5 LSK will take you to New Waypoint page.
IDENT Type in the name of the waypoint you want to create, for example LH01 in our
case.
Press the L1 LSK
LAT/LONG Here you need to enter Latitude/Longitude in the format- xxxx.xN/xxxxx.xE we used 3319.0N/07802.0E for LH01
Press L2 LSK
Press on R6 LSK "STORE" Now, you have successfully entered your waypoint you have to select STORE to save it. You can enter the waypoint in your flight plan like any other waypoint.
Now you can use this new waypoint in your F-PLN page
Note: If you have duplicate waypoints with the same names, check the coordinates when they
appear as options in the fmc/mcdu while entering them in flight plan. Wait for the IRS to align
so the closest waypoints with similar names appear first.
Boeing B737-700/800
Press INDEX (L6 LSK) Press on NAV DATA (R1 LSK)
Type the name of the waypoint
Press R6 LSK
to get it in the box
On ce the waypoint is in the box
Press on LH01(R6 LSK) again to confirm it
Enter Latitude LAT Format- Nxxxx.x
Press L3 LSK
Enter Longitude
LONG Format- Exxxx.x
Press R3 LSK
Recheck LAT/LONG
Press EXEC to store it
Just like Airbus you can enter the custom
waypoints in your flight plan just like any
other waypoint
